Start with one quick puzzle: arrange every word into a statement that is both grammatical and true. Each solve unlocks the source-backed story behind it—and the next challenge. Click or drag the scrambled tiles into the order you think makes sense. Your sentence must be grammatical and defensibly true—not merely close.     The story For people based in Edinburgh (Scotland), you may know Codebase, the legendary co-working space and tech incubator. Few years ago, when the local coffee shop was called Elm cafe and run by Ally, her coffee machine would have a new fun fact written on it every day. All one had to do was to guess, is the statement Fact or Fiction? And Ally, also a great storyteller would reveal to you, whether you are in luck today.   • Hi HN, I built Eigendrum, a web tool that solves the 2D wave equation for arbitrary shapes so you can hear what they sound like as drums. How it works: * Solves -∇²u = λu using finite element analysis (Kφ = λMφ) on a triangle mesh. * Validated to <0.1% error against closed-form solutions for circles (Bessel zeros) and rectangles. * Sound model factors in strike location, Rayleigh damping, and mallet width. * Includes Kac drums I & II to demonstrate identical sound spectra from different geometries. * No frameworks, build steps, or dependencies.
